A New Day's Dawn
Drops of dew on leaves just kissed
The fog rolls out, a windows mist
Birds sing their song, grazing deer, ears a twitch
Experienced the same, the poor, the rich
The Moon settles down, the Sun peaks out
Rested eyes are opened, critters scurry about
Good Morning Earth, Good Morning Sun
It's a new day, Earth's dawn has begun
